Revert of PictureBenchmark JSON logging (https://codereview.chromium.org/286903025/)
Reason for revert: Broke some Windows builds; see http://skbug.com/2609 ('certain Windows Build-* bots failing since r14905'). Before re-landing with a fix, please send to some of the trybots that failed the first time.
